Hard-Numbers: Technical Specifications

  • Series: I/A Series Fieldbus
  • Module Compatibility: FBM231 Field Device System Integrator Module (Four Serial Ports, Redundant)
  • Termination Type: Compression Screw
  • Supported Interfaces:
    • RS-232 (DB-25 cable to modem/converter): Up to 15 m (50 ft)
    • RS-422: Up to 1200 m (3937 ft)
    • RS-485: Up to 1200 m (3937 ft)
  • Transmission Rates: 300, 600, 1200, 2400, 4800, 9600, 19200, 38400, 57600 baud
  • Termination Cable Type: Type 5 (LSZH cable jacket)
  • Available Cable Lengths:
    • 1.0 m (3.2 ft): RH928AW (supersedes P0928AW)
    • 2.0 m (6.6 ft): RH928AX (supersedes P0928AX)
    • 3.0 m (9.8 ft): RH928AY (supersedes P0928AY)
    • 5.0 m (16.4 ft): RH928AZ (supersedes P0928AZ)
  • Dimensions:
    • Height: 111 mm (4.37 in)
    • Width: 80 mm (3.13 in)
    • Depth: 72 mm (2.83 in)
    • Mounting Hole Centers: 216 mm (8.51 in)
  • Weight: 272 g (0.6 lb) approximate
  • Cable Temperature Range: -40 to +105°C (-40 to +221°F) (LSZH jacket)
  • Cable Material: Low Smoke Zero Halogen (LSZH) thermoplastic or thermoset compounds

The Real-World Problem It Solves

Serial communication with field devices, PLCs, and third-party equipment often requires organized, secure field wiring terminations. Loose connections, improper grounding, and cable management issues cause intermittent communication failures in industrial environments. The RH926GH termination assembly provides a standardized, compression screw termination point that ensures reliable wire connections for RS-232/422/485 interfaces, supports long-distance communication (up to 1200 m for RS-422/485), and uses LSZH cable material for safety in hazardous or enclosed environments.
Where you’ll typically find it:
  • Multi-protocol gateway installations connecting Foxboro DCS to Modbus/Profibus networks
  • Remote terminal unit (RTU) connections via serial links
  • Smart instrument integration through serial communication interfaces
  • Legacy equipment migration projects requiring RS-232/422/485 connectivity
  • Third-party controller and PLC communication links
Bottom line: It provides reliable, standardized field wiring termination for FBM231 serial communication interfaces with support for multiple protocols and long-distance cabling.

Hardware Architecture & Under-the-Hood Logic

This termination assembly serves as the field wiring interface between the FBM231 module and external serial communication devices. It uses compression screw terminals for secure wire connections and provides termination points for RS-232, RS-422, and RS-485 interfaces.
  1. The FBM231 module connects to the RH926GH termination assembly via Type 5 LSZH cable (lengths: 1-5 meters).
  2. Field devices or modems connect to the termination assembly through designated terminal points for each protocol.
  3. RS-232 connections use DB-25 cables (up to 15 m) connecting to customer-supplied devices or modems.
  4. RS-422 and RS-485 connections support longer distances (up to 1200 m) using 4-wire physical media.
  5. Compression screw terminals provide secure, vibration-resistant wire connections for all signal lines.
  6. The assembly isolates field wiring from the module, allowing for hot-swappable maintenance without disrupting system operation.
  7. LSZH cable jacket material ensures limited smoke and halogen emissions during fire exposure, meeting safety requirements for enclosed environments.
  8. Multiple baud rates (300-57600) are supported to accommodate various device communication requirements.
  9. The assembly mounts on Modular Baseplate alongside FBM231, providing organized cable management in enclosures.

Field Service Pitfalls: What Rookies Get Wrong

Incorrect Cable Length SelectionRookies select the wrong termination cable length between FBM231 and RH926GH, causing installation issues or excessive cable slack. The assembly only supports specific cable lengths (1.0, 2.0, 3.0, or 5.0 meters).
  • Field Rule: Verify the required distance between the module and termination assembly before installation. Use only the specified cable lengths (RH928AW/AX/AY/AZ) to ensure proper fit and cable management in the enclosure.
Mixing RS-232 and RS-422/485 WiringTechnicians incorrectly wire RS-232 devices to RS-422/485 terminals or vice versa. This causes communication failures because the physical layer requirements differ significantly (point-to-point vs. multi-drop).
  • Quick Fix: Identify the communication protocol required by the connected device before wiring. RS-232 uses DB-25 connectors for point-to-point links up to 15 meters. RS-422/485 use terminal block connections supporting longer distances and multi-drop configurations. Verify device documentation for correct interface type.
Exceeding Maximum Cable DistanceNew engineers deploy RS-422/485 cabling beyond the 1200-meter limit, assuming Ethernet-like distance capabilities. Signal degradation and communication timeouts occur beyond the specified maximum.
  • Field Rule: For RS-422/485 connections, ensure total cable length does not exceed 1200 meters (3937 feet). If longer distances are required, install repeaters or optical converters. For RS-232, never exceed 15 meters between termination assembly and connected device.
Poor Compression Screw TerminationInstallers don’t properly strip wire length or over-tighten compression screws, causing weak connections or broken strands. Loose terminals result in intermittent communication failures that are difficult to diagnose.
  • Field Rule: Strip wire insulation according to the termination assembly specifications (typically 6-8 mm). Insert fully into the compression terminal and tighten screw to manufacturer-specified torque. Do not over-tighten, which can damage terminal hardware. Perform a pull-test to verify secure connection.
Ignoring LSZH Cable Requirements in Hazardous AreasRookies replace LSZH (Low Smoke Zero Halogen) termination cables with standard PVC jacketed cable in hazardous or enclosed environments. During fire conditions, non-LSZH cables emit toxic smoke and halogens, violating safety standards.
  • Quick Fix: Always use the specified Type 5 LSZH cables (RH928 series) for connections between FBM231 and RH926GH in hazardous or confined spaces. LSZH material emits limited smoke and no halogens when exposed to fire, meeting IEC safety requirements for enclosed industrial environments.
